NFRC rating system and labeling system for energy performance windows, doors, skylights, and attachment products

The National Fenestration Rating Council (NFRC) is a non-profit organisation that administers a uniform and independent labeling system for the energy efficiency of doors, windows skylights, skylights and other attachement products. This label lets consumers make informed decisions about energy efficient products.

Energy ratings are a complement to other NFRC labels, such as structural performance and air quality ratings. These ratings can be used to determine the overall energy efficiency of a building.

Products that are NFRC-certified are independently tested and certified by an outside party. The certification process is a non-biased examination of product production, design, and participation in the NFRC rating system and labeling system.

The NFRC is a part of numerous companies in the field of fenestration. The organization was founded in response to the energy crises of the 1970s. Today, NFRC includes government agencies, researchers and manufacturers as well as suppliers. Its ratings are utilized in all major energy efficiency programmes.

The NFRC website provides information regarding the NFRC labeling process. The labels offer information about the manufacturer and energy performance ratings.
